 Up for your consideration is a 1972 Buick Skylark Custom. This nice looking Skylark belongs to a friend of mine who buys a lot off E-bay but he has never sold anything, so he asked me if I would. He is the second owner of the vehicle, he bought it over a year ago from one of the original family members who bought it new here in Atlanta in 1972, he has the paperwork to prove that. He began the process of restoring it while he drove it. It has a new top with a glass rear window, new carpet, and a fresh paint job. This is the original color, Sunburst Yellow, but my friend decided to have real metal flake put in the paint so that it sparkles in the sun. I tried to take some pictures up close so you could see the metal flake. This is an all original car except, from what my friend was told by the original owner,  they had replaced the original motor with a '72 350 motor from another Skylark that had lower mileage. The car starts and seems to run fine after it warms up. There is no smoke or clatter or any engine noise. I took it out for a cruise yesterday and it seemed to run fine. It would hesitate a couple of times on acceleration but would clear up after about 30-40 MPH and ran fine. All the windows worked  fine a week ago, but when I came back home from my cruise yesterday, the front passenger window did not go up, probably a switch and I will do my best to get it checked out this week. The only other issue that I have found with the car is that one of the brakes seems to grab harder than the other. If you hit the brakes quickly it wants to pull to the right but all the brakes are working. My guess is that there is a caliper sticking, having not been driven much in recent months. This is a southern car, so rust is not an issue, the doors are solids, the quarter panels are solid. I took everything out of the trunk so that you could hopefully see that the trunk floor pans are solid. There are some small pinholes in the trunk pans but this is where water had gotten into the trunk, nothing serious. The electric top works fine and closes securely. The interior is in good shape as you can see from the pictures. It is missing the passenger side sun visor, but an easy fix, it is also missing the belt on the air conditioner but is otherwise intact. This is a great looking convertible that you could drive while you finish the restoration. Opel to be shuttered in China, but will restart Buick production in Germany

Fri, 28 Mar 2014

Opel, General Motors' troubled German brand continues its quest to reinvent itself and find solid profitability. In the course of that metamorphosis, the company has a bit of good news/bad news today. The good news is, it will once again begin screwing together Buick models for the American market. The bad news, though, is that it's being shut down in yet another country, China.
Let's start with the good news. The last vehicle Opel's Ruesselsheim factory built for the North American market was the early run of the then-new Regal, which is based heavily on the Opel Insignia. Production ran for just over two years, from 2009 to 2011, before moving production to Oshawa, Ontario.
Now, thanks to a 245-million-euro investment (just over $336 million), Opel will kick off production of a unspecified model for the US in the "second half of the decade," according to Automotive News. According to Opel, the new model will be announced before the end of 2014. First 2013 Buick Encore TV ad features... dinosaurs

Thu, 14 Mar 2013

The whole "SUVs as dinosaurs" trope has become something of a threadbare cliché among auto writers, but that doesn't mean the wider world of consumers has caught on to the Jurassic nature of our line of thinking. That's what General Motors appears to be betting on, at least. Just check out Buick's first television spot for its 2013 Encore, the tiny crossover that is pushing the Tri-Shield into territories unknown while looking to outrun the brand's reputation as a refuge for elderly clientele.
Set to air this weekend on ESPN during the NCAA college basketball tournament, the ad plays up the Encore's maneuverability and surprising interior space by setting the baby Buick amongst a herd of lumbering CG dinosaurs created by Tippett Studio, the folks behind Hollywood blockbusters like Jurassic Park, Ted, and the Twilight series of films.
We can't help but snigger a little - while the Encore is indeed surprisingly roomy, nimble, and composed, our first drive found it to be glacially slow, too... not unlike a certain prehistoric race of animals. Check out the commercial below and judge for yourself.

2014 Buick LaCrosse steps up to the big leagues with plenty of luxury

Wed, 27 Mar 2013

Following the introduction of the updated 2014 Buick LaCrosse and Regal, the oldest vehicle in Buick's lineup will be the Verano, which was just introduced last year. Having such a fresh product mix bodes well for Buick as it tries to create a new image in the US, and after checking out the amount of luxury being stuffed into the new LaCrosse for 2014, GM's awkwardly positioned brand may finally have the ability to stand out.
Granted, the model unveiled was the all-new, top-of-the-line Ultra Luxury Interior Package, but this package brings top-notch leather and soft suede covering everything above the beltline as well as real ash wood accent trim throughout the cabin. While there was no mention of price, we don't expect this model to come cheap in terms of what we expect from Buick, although it will likely be competitively priced with similarly equipped rivals like the Acura TL or Lexus ES. Adding even more to the LaCrosse's interior, dual eight-inch displays make up the gauge cluster and center stack, and the number of buttons on the center stack have been greatly reduced, creating a cleaner look for the instrument panel.
Another big change is the next-generation of Buick's IntelliLink infotainment system that brings with it all of the recent enhancements of the Cadillac CUE and Chevrolet MyLink systems. Differentiating itself from other GM infotainment systems, the new Buick IntelliLink stands out by allowing users to customize the apps they can add and not just being limited to what GM sees fit.
